Abstract

This research study aimed to develop English speaking materials to support the learning process in Conversation class of the tenth-graders at Madrasah Aliyah (Islamic senior high school) Al Ma’had An Nur, Bantul. This research was a research and development study. The development was carried out through several steps, namely the needs analysis, a course grid design, product development, product validation, product revisions, try-outs, and final product development. The research had two results. First, it produced a set of speaking materials in the form of printed books. Second, the findings showed that the materials were appropriate to be applied in the Conversation class of the tenth-graders at Madrasah Aliyah Al Ma’had An Nur, Bantul considering the result of the materials evaluation by experts and students’ try-outs. They scored 3.59 and 3.32 for the mean score of the scale 1 to 4 and were categorized as “Very Good”.

Abstract

Penelitian ini mengungkapkan tiga pembahasan, yakni bagaimana implementasi ekstrakurikuler English Club di MIN 2 Sleman, bagaimana hasil yang dicapai dalam kegiatan ekstrakurikuler tersebut dilihat dalam konteks kecerdasan linguistiknya, dan apa saja faktor pendukung dan penghambat selama kegiatan ekstrakurikuler ini berjalan. Penelitian ini adalah penelitian kualitatif dengan pendekatan fenomenologi. Metode pengumpulan data menggunakan observasi, wawancara, dan dokumentasi. Sedangkan Teknik Analisis Data merujuk pada Miles dan Hubberman, yakni data reduction (reduksi data), data display (penyajian data), dan conclusion drawing/ Verification (menarik kesimpulan). Hasil dari penelitian ini adalah implementasi ekstrakurikuler ini meliputi dua tahapan, yakni tahapan persiapan dan tahapan proses. Sedangkan hasil perkembangan kecerdasan linguistik siswa melalui kegiatan ekstrakurikuler English Club ini mencakup keterampilan mendengar, keterampilan berbicara, keterampilan menulis, dan keterampilan membaca. Adapun faktor pendukungnya adalah peran kepala madrasah yang kuat, kualitas guru yang profesional, minat dan kecerdasan siswa yang baik, dan alat atau media yang mudah didapat. Sedangkan faktor penghambatnya antara lain kegiatan ini bukan materi wajib, kurangnya minat bimbingan di rumah, dan media pembelajaran yang belum diperbarui.

Abstract

This research aimed to find out how the implementation of authentic assessment in online learning for fiqh subjects in class XI IIK 2 MA Al Ma'had An-Nur Bantul. This research was qualitative research with data collection techniques using observation, interviews, and documentation. While the data analysis method used the theory of Miles and Huberman. Not only that, the checking technique of the data validity used several criteria. The research results revealed that (1) includes competency assessment during the online learning process, the teacher saw student activity when participating in learning through Google Meet. (2) Knowledge Competence using written assessment instrument techniques and assignments or projects. (3) The psychomotor competence of students to practice creative and innovative skills. The assessment results could be seen from two things, namely, students were able to understand the material provided, and students were trained in honest behavior. The supporting factors were teachers, school facilities, and quota assistance. While the inhibiting factors were that the assessment was not very effective during the pandemic, learning was not conducive, and the lack of communication between teachers and students so that the administrators were overwhelmed in dealing with existing problems
